Skip to content

Commit c208f87

Browse files
Only run benchmarking on pull requests
1 parent ed9a80b commit c208f87

2 files changed

Lines changed: 4 additions & 4 deletions

File tree

.github/workflows/continous-benchmark.yml

Lines changed: 3 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-1,10 +1,11 @@
11
name: Run benchmark
22
on:
3-
push:
3+
pull_request:
4+
branches: [ main ]
45

56
jobs:
67
benchmark:
7-
name: Performance regression check
8+
name: Continuous benchmarking
89
runs-on: ubuntu-latest
910

1011
defaults:

src/GeoJSON.Text.Test.Benchmark/SerializeAndDeserialize.cs

Lines changed: 1 addition &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-46,7 +46,6 @@ public Text.Feature.FeatureCollection DeserializeFeatureCollection() => System.T
4646
?? throw new NullReferenceException("Deserialization should not return a null value.");
4747

4848
[Benchmark]
49-
public string SerializeFeatureCollection() => System.Text.Json.JsonSerializer.Serialize(fileContents)
50-
?? throw new NullReferenceException("Deserialization should not return a null value.");
49+
public string SerializeFeatureCollection() => System.Text.Json.JsonSerializer.Serialize(fileContents);
5150
}
5251
}

0 commit comments

Comments
 (0)